Transaction 607886bc6f87fe739c33f70100f43c47e78c333c3cdd456fc2623f12b460ced1
1 Input
1 Output
-
607886bc6f87fe739c33f70100f43c47e78c333c3cdd456fc2623f12b460ced1:0
- value
- 50504
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 81d489c9baec513ff9892b27426f1424212eaabe OP_EQUAL
- address
- 3DXVhhrs8sJR1R8aMQTq7zoHeMKLJjUT8S